How to Pair Your Samsung Sound by AKG Earbuds

Connecting your Samsung Sound by AKG earbuds is a straightforward process, but it may vary slightly depending on the type of device you are using. Here is a step-by-step guide for both Android devices and iOS devices.

Connecting to an Android Device

The vast majority of Samsung Sound by AKG earbuds are designed to be used seamlessly with Android devices. Follow these simple steps:

Step 1: Preparing Your Earbuds

  • Ensure your earbuds are charged. Most models offer a several-hour listening time on a full charge.
  • Turn on your device by pressing and holding the power button typically located on the right earbud for a few seconds.

Step 2: Enable Bluetooth on Your Android Device

  1. Unlock your Android device and go to Settings.
  2. Select Connections and tap on Bluetooth.
  3. Turn on Bluetooth by toggling the switch to the On position.

Step 3: Connecting Your Earbuds

  1. With your earbuds in pairing mode, they should automatically appear in the list of available devices on your phone.
  2. Tap on the name of your earbuds (e.g., “Galaxy Buds Pro” or “AKG Earbuds”).
  3. Confirm any prompts, and your earbuds should connect.

Connecting to an iOS Device

For iPhone or iPad users, connecting your Samsung Sound by AKG earbuds is just as easy. Here’s how:

Step 1: Preparing Your Earbuds

  • Ensure they are charged beforehand.
  • Put your earbuds into pairing mode by holding the power button.

Step 2: Enable Bluetooth on Your iOS Device

  1. Unlock your iPhone or iPad and open Settings.
  2. Tap on Bluetooth and toggle it to the On position.

Step 3: Connecting Your Earbuds

  1. Check for the earbuds in the list of available devices.
  2. Tap on your earbuds’ name to establish a connection.
  3. Confirm any prompts that appear on the screen.

Troubleshooting Connection Issues

While connecting your Samsung Sound by AKG earbuds is typically straightforward, you may encounter issues from time to time. Here are several troubleshooting tips to help you resolve these problems.

Common Issues and Solutions

  • Earbuds Not Showing in Bluetooth List: If your earbuds aren’t appearing in your Bluetooth list, ensure they are in pairing mode. Some models require you to hold the power button for longer.
  • Intermittent Connectivity: If you experience audio dropouts, try turning Bluetooth off and on again on your device. Also, ensure that you are within close range of your earbuds.

Resetting Your Earbuds

If persistent issues occur, you may need to reset your earbuds:

  1. Turn off your earbuds.
  2. Press and hold the power button for approximately 10 seconds until you see a flashing light.
  3. Reattempt the pairing process as described above.

What devices are compatible with Samsung Sound by AKG Earbuds?

Samsung Sound by AKG Earbuds are designed to work seamlessly with a variety of devices that support Bluetooth technology. This includes the latest Samsung Galaxy smartphones, tablets, wearable devices, and laptops. Additionally, these earbuds are compatible with other Bluetooth-enabled devices, such as PCs, MacBooks, and even some smart TVs, making them a versatile choice for audio lovers.

It’s essential to check the Bluetooth version on your devices to ensure optimal connectivity. Most modern gadgets will have Bluetooth 4.1 or higher, which works well with these earbuds. Make sure your device supports the A2DP profile for high-quality audio streaming. This means you can enjoy superior sound without any hassle as long as your gadget meets these requirements.

What should I do if I experience audio lag while using the earbuds?

If you experience audio lag while using your Samsung Sound by AKG Earbuds, several factors could be contributing to the issue. First, check that both your earbuds and the device you are connected to have the latest software updates installed. Sometimes, outdated firmware can lead to performance issues. You can update your device’s software through its settings menu and check for firmware updates for the earbuds using the Galaxy Wearable app.

Another common cause of audio lag is interference from other wireless devices. Try disconnecting other Bluetooth devices or moving to a different location away from electronic gadgets that may cause interference. Also, ensure that your earbuds are within the recommended range of the connected device. If the problem persists, resetting your earbuds to factory settings may help to resolve connectivity problems.

How do I enhance the audio quality of my earbuds?

To enhance the audio quality of your Samsung Sound by AKG Earbuds, you can utilize the equalizer settings available on your connected device. Most smartphones and music apps come with built-in equalizers that allow you to adjust the sound profile according to your preferences. Finding the right balance of bass, midrange, and treble can dramatically improve your listening experience.

Additionally, ensure that you are using high-quality audio files for playback. Compressed audio formats may not deliver the full potential of your earbuds. Consider streaming from high-fidelity music services or using lossless formats to experience every detail in your music. Proper earbud fit is also crucial, as a secure seal can significantly enhance passive noise isolation and audio quality.

How do I reset my Samsung Sound by AKG Earbuds?

If you’re experiencing issues with your Samsung Sound by AKG Earbuds, resetting them can often resolve minor glitches. To reset your earbuds, start by placing them in the charging case and ensuring they are charging. Then, touch and hold both the left and right earbuds for about seven seconds until you see the LED light flash red and blue, indicating that they are resetting.

After the reset, you will need to reconnect the earbuds to your device as they will no longer be paired. Enter Bluetooth settings on your smartphone, find the earbuds in the available devices list, and select them to establish a new connection. This process helps clear any previous pairing data and can restore functionality when needed.
